Guidelines for Medication and Vaccine Injection Safety

Hi, everyone: Please see the attached memo regarding the joint document titled Guidelines for Medication and Vaccine Injection Safety (December, 2016) recently released by CARNA The document was developed in collaboration with the College of Physicians & Surgeons of Alberta and the Alberta College of Pharmacists.   Regards Terri Woytkiw AGNA President   2016-12-22-stakeholders-memo-re-guidelines-for-medication-and-vaccine-injection-safety-december-2016

CARNA’s MAiD Framework request for feedback

As nurses supporting older adults, we need to recognize the impact that Bill 14: An Act to amend the Criminal Code and make related amendments to other acts (Medial Assistance in Dying) will have on our practice. Please reflect upon your personal and professional views by reviewing documents currently in development by CARNA…
